Traditionally, the Ibu Mertua (mother-in-law) in literature and film was the ultimate antagonist. She represented the "gatekeeper" of the household, often viewed as a threat to the romantic bliss of a newlywed couple. This trope stems from a universal anxiety: the shift of a son’s primary loyalty from his mother to his wife.
